Redefining Artificial Intelligence through Open AI:
Overview.
One of the top research groups for artificial intelligence (AI) in the world, Open AI is committed to developing digital intelligence in ways that are secure and advantageous to people. It was established with the goal of ensuring that all of mankind benefits from artificial general intelligence (AGI), which is defined as highly autonomous systems that perform better than humans at the most economically valuable tasks.
How Open AI Got Started.
A collection of prominent figures in the IT industry, including Elon Musk, Sam Altman, Greg Brockman, ILYASUTSKEVER, WOJCIECH ZAREMBA, and John Schulman, launched Open AI in December 2015. Their objective was to establish a non-profit, transparent, cooperative, and open research organization with the mission of making sure that AGI does not threaten human existence and stays consistent with human ideals. The quick development of AI and its enormous potential for gains as well as threats drove the foundation of Open AI. The founders felt that the proper development of such powerful technology required an organization that was transparent, well-governed, and ethically guided
Change from the "Capped-Profit" Model to the Non-Profit Model.
Open AI was first established as a non-profit, but in order to draw in additional funding and expand its research, it switched to a "capped-profit" model in 2019. With the Open AI LP, a new type of structure, investors can earn returns up to 100 times their initial investment, with any surplus earnings being reinvested in the organization's objectives. What Is The Work Of Open AI?
Natural language processing (NLP), robotics, reinforcement learning, machine learning, and other fields of AI study are the focus of Open AI. Among its most innovative accomplishments is the creation of massive language models, such as GPT-3 and GPT-4. Numerous contemporary AI applications, such as chatbots, text generators, and coding assistants, are built on top of these models.
Important Fields of Study: 1. NLP, or natural language processing:
The GPT models from Open AI, particularly GPT-3 and GPT-4, are made to comprehend and produce human language. Large text datasets are used to pre-train these models, which are then refined for specialized tasks like question answering, text generation, and other intricate language-related operations. 2. Learning via Reinforcement:
In order to educate agents (AI systems) in dynamic contexts where they learn by trial and error, Open AI investigates reinforcement learning. The renowned "Open AI Five" bot, which demonstrated superhuman skills in the multiplayer game "DOTA 2," was trained using this methodology. 3. Automation:
Models for robotic systems have been created by Open AI, which has also conducted research in fields including simulated environments and actual robotic manipulation. 4. Ethics and Safety:

By using enormous amounts of data and processing power to train its models, Open AI creates AI models. Usually, the procedure goes through these steps: 1. Gathering Data:
To train its models, Open AI gathers enormous datasets from a variety of sources, including as books, websites, scholarly articles, and other publicly accessible content. The AI can pick up information, linguistic patterns, and reasoning abilities thanks to these datasets.
2. Models of Training:
Open AI trains models with deep learning approaches, namely "transformer architecture," leveraging robust computational infrastructure (GPU/TPU clusters). This approach has proven quite effective in handling tasks such as text production and language modeling. 3. Adjustment and Repetition:
After the base model has been trained, Open AI uses "human feedback" and "reinforcement learning" to maximize the model's performance for particular tasks. Models are modified, for instance, to manage real-world issues or provide more effective answers to inquiries. 4. Public Access and Deployment:
Through APIs, Open AI makes its models available to developers, companies, and researchers. These APIs provide access to services like "Chat GPT," "Codex," and "DALL·E," which have been integrated into a variety of businesses, including software development, content creation, and customer service. Key Contributions of Open AI.
The Generative Pretrained Transformer (GPT) series:
The most notable contribution of Open AI to AI has been the creation of the "GPT" series, specifically "GPT-3" and "GPT-4." These models have found application in a variety of fields, including question answering, essay writing, coding, art creation, and even problem solving. Codex:
Code-to-natural-language conversion software, such as GitHub Copilot, helps software developers write and comprehend code more effectively. It is powered by Open AI's 'Codex' AI model.
DALL·E:
A text-to-image creation model called "DALL·E" is capable of producing incredibly imaginative and detailed visuals from written descriptions. The realm of AI-generated entertainment and art has undergone a revolutionary change. Accessible AI API:
